Add sanity checks to UpdateDelayStatistics and patch unit tests.
RtpPacket::UpdateDelayStatistics was previously optimized with several sanity checks added. These sanity checks caused many of the unit tests in peerconnection_integration_unittests to fail and the CL was therefore reverted. This CL contains the sanity checks along with patches so that the unit tests pass.
